Ubuntu

java 外掛在 chromium-browser 中不起作用(所有可能的嘗試都用盡了)

  • November 19, 2014

我在 Ubuntu 12.04 機器上使用 google chrome 瀏覽器,最近我需要切換到 chromium-browser。我正在使用 Ubuntu 軟體中心提供的版本。問題是我不能再讓 java applet 載入了。

這是我的情況——

  1. 我正在使用 oracle 中的 vanilla jdk ( jdk 1.7.0_51 )。
  2. 以前在 chrome 中,我創建了一個libnpjp2.so指向該/opt/google/chrome/plugins文件夾的符號連結,java 小程序工作正常。
  3. 解除安裝 chrome 並安裝 chromium-browser 後,我創建了libnpjp2.so指向/usr/lib/chromium-browser/plugins文件夾的符號連結,但 java 小程序不再啟動(即使來自此站點:http ://www.java.com/en/download/installed.jsp )
  4. 甚至libnpjp2.so出現在about:pluginschromium-browser 中並顯示它已啟用。

到目前為止我嘗試過的 -

  1. 解除安裝chrome後,/opt/google/chrome它仍然存在,我將其刪除
  2. 將符號連結作為上述第 3 點設置為/usr/lib/chromium-browser/plugins,但沒有運氣。
  3. 所以我icedtea-7-plugins從 Ubuntu repo 安裝並創建了IcedTeaPlugin.soto的符號連結/usr/lib/chromium-browser/plugins,但沒有運氣,所以我刪除了它。
  4. 將 java 小程序測試頁面添加到 java 控制面板的排除列表中。
  5. 從 Java 控制面板清除臨時 Internet 文件。
  6. 在 chromium-browser 中執行了多個“啟用/禁用”java 外掛循環。
  7. 用開關啟動鉻瀏覽器-enable-plugins不起作用。

當我進入java小程序測試頁面時,我只能看到一個灰色的矩形,沒有別的。請注意,在 chrome 瀏覽器和 firefox 上一切正常。另請注意,我不想安裝 openjdk 的東西。

任何的想法 ?

正如在AskUbuntu中發現的那樣:

Java (IcedTea) 沒有可用的 PPAPI 外掛,因此無法在 Chromium 中使用,因為 Trusty 中的 Chromium 34 已切換到 Aura 渲染框架並且不再允許 NPAPI 外掛。另請參閱 https://bugs.launchpad.net/ubuntu/+source/chromium-browser/+bug/1308783

我想這與 Oracle Java 外掛相同。至少它適用於 Firefox,因此您可以使用 FF,直到 PPAPI 實現可用。

您是否在about:plugins菜單中啟用了外掛?要在您的地址欄類型中訪問它about:plugins

                #1

確保外掛已啟用。

其他要嘗試的事情

  1. 瀏覽 Chromium 的未解決問題。以下是JDK 引用的未解決問題列表。
  2. ./ControlPanel通過 JDK 的對話框確認外掛已啟用。詳情在這裡
  3. KB Mozillazine 主題中關於 Java的其他建議。
  4. 嘗試降級到舊版本的 JDK,以確認問題不在於 1.7.0_51。

引用自:https://unix.stackexchange.com/questions/125297